Styling Tips to Protect Hair in Summers

Must Read

With the onset of summer, the scorching heat starts soaring high. Sweat and pollution contribute to hair woes and sun damage caused by the ultraviolet rays has an adverse effect as it breaks the melanin shield present in the hair follicle. With stylish head gears, bandanas and dupattas, one can leave an everlasting style statement.
Vintage look: Classy hat
Wearing a hat protects the scalp, hair and skin around the neck and the ears.
Play the Indian wardrobe
For girls, dupattas as headgears can work wonders. One can wrap a dupatta around the head and cover it entirely. Cotton duppattas mostly soak the unwanted sweat released from the scalp and keep the hair fresh and tidy. It also helps to evade the dust and pollution seeping in the hair and scalp.
Go the bandana way
A bandana not only keeps the head warm, but also protects the forehead from getting exposed to the sun’s rays. It also adds to the style factor and makes one look trendy and keeps the hair falling off face.
Cappy affair
For men, caps are an easy solution. Caps come in varied shapes and sizes and is also make a fashion statement. Caps block the sun rays and protect the skin from sun damage.
